Price of anarchy for machine load balancing game with 3 machines
Julia V. Chirkova IAMR KarRC RAS, Cand.Sc.
Abstract:
The Machine Load Balancing Game with 3 machines is considered. A set of n jobs is to be assigned to a set of 3 machines with different speeds. Jobs choose machines to minimize their own delays. The social cost of a schedule is the maximum delay among all machines, i.e. makespan. For this model the upper bound estimation of the Price of Anarchy is obtained. This upper bound estimation is an exact estimation of the Price of Anarchy for the case when the speed of the fastest machine is enough large. Conditions of PoA increasing with addition a machine in the system of 2 machines are found.
